Official abstract text for this publication.
The presently disclosed subject matter is directed to a positive electrode active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ery including a lithium transition metal-containing composite oxide, comprising secondary particles formed by aggregates of primary particles. The secondary particles comprise: an outer-shell section formed by an aggregate of the primary particles; at least one aggregate section formed by an aggregate of primary particles and existing on an inside of the outer-shell section, and electrically and structurally connected to the outer-shell section; and at least one space section existing on the inside of the outer-shell section and in which there are no primary particles. The average particle size of the secondary particles being within the range 1 μm to 15 μm, an index [(d90-d10)/average particle size] that indicates a spread of a particle size distribution of the secondary particles being 0.7 or less, and the surface area per unit volume being 1.7 m2/cm3 or greater.

What is claimed is: 1. A positive electrode active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ery including a lithium transition metal-containing composite oxide, comprising secondary particles formed by aggregates of primary particles; the secondary particles comprising: an outer-shell section formed by an aggregate of the primary particles; at least one aggregate section formed by an aggregate of primary particles and existing on an inside of the outer-shell section, and electrically and structurally connected to the outer-shell section; and at least one space section existing on the inside of the outer-shell section and in which there are no primary particles; and the average particle size of the secondary particles being within the range 1 μm to 15 μm, an index [(d90−d10)/average particle size] that indicates a spread of a particle size distribution of the secondary particles being 0.7 or less, and the surface area per unit volume being 1.7 m 2 /cm 3 or greater. 2. The positive electrode active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te according to claim 1 , wherein the BET specific surface area is within the range 0.7 m 2 /g to 5.0 m 2 /g. 3. The positive electrode active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te according to claim 1 , wherein the positive electrode active material includes lithium transition metal-containing composite oxide that has a composition that is expressed by the general formula (B): Li 1+u Ni x Mn y Co z M t O 2 (where, −0.05≤u≤0.50,x+y+z+t=1, 0.3≤x≤0.95, 0.05≤y≤0.55, 0≤z≤0.4, 0≤t≤0.1, and M is at least one additional element selected from among Mg, Ca, Al, Ti, V, Cr, Zr, Nb, Mo, Hf, Ta and W); and has a layered hexagonal crystal type crystal structure. 4. A non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ery comprising a positive electrode, a negative electrode, a separator and a non-aqueous electrolyte, wherein the positive electrode active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ery according to claim 1 is used as the positive electrode material of the positive electrode.
